8 Companies You Can Work While Studying

If you are considering going back to school as you work part-time or looking for a company that would invest in your education rather you work part-time/full-time.


Here are a few companies that will pay for your college:


📦 UPS - PT employees receive up to $5,250 in tuition assistance


🍦 Publix (the Nordstrom of grocery stores lol) - reimbursement of courses rather online or technical training and is available to all associates may be reimbursed up to $1,700


☕️ Starbucks - US based employees working an avg of 20hrs w/ no degree are eligible for the Starbucks College Achievement Plan; eligible employees in partnership with Arizona State University May pursue an undergrad degree


📲 Verizon - regular/part time domestic associates working at least 17 hours may be eligible for tuition assistance


🏰 Disney - offers 100% tuition paid upfront at Disney Aspire network schools; part time hourly employees and FT


🛠 Home Depot - tuition assistance provided to full time associates, part time and immediate family ranging from $2,500 - $6,000 depending on job status (PT, FT or family)


🛒 Walmart - partnered with Guild Education to offer eligible associates flexible options for education


🍕 Papa Johns - tuition reimbursement offered after 90 days for employees working at least 20hrs/week.
